Oil companies now making losses of Rs 750 crores a day, down from Rs 1000 crores earlier: MoPNG
The Indian Public sector Oil Marketing Companies (OMCs) have managed to reduce their losses to Rs 750 crores a day down from Rs 1000 crores a day earlier amid the on going West Asia crisis which has been putting pressure on the oil companies due to disruption…
